/* CSS for sp-location-weather-pro/section-heading - spl-weather-heading-4c9cede2a679 */
#spl-weather-heading-4c9cede2a679 .spl-weather-section-heading-text {font-size: 23px;line-height: 27px;letter-spacing: 0px;color: #718096;font-weight: 500;background: transparent;padding: 0px 0px 0px 0px;border-style: none;border-radius: 0px 0px 0px 0px;}#spl-weather-heading-4c9cede2a679 .spl-weather-section-sub-heading-text {font-size: 16px;line-height: 19px;letter-spacing: 0px;color: oklch(from #3182CE calc(l + 0.10 * (1 - l)) calc(c * 1.00) calc(h + 180) / 100%);font-weight: 500;background: transparent;padding: 0px 0px 0px 0px;border-style: none;border-radius: 0px 0px 0px 0px;}#spl-weather-heading-4c9cede2a679.spl-weather-section-heading-block-wrapper {gap: 5px;background: transparent;border-style: none;border-radius: 0px 0px 0px 0px;padding: 0px 0px 0px 0px;margin: 90px 0px 40px 0px;}#spl-weather-heading-4c9cede2a679.spl-weather-section-heading-block-wrapper > div {justify-content: left;} @media only screen and (min-width: 600px) and (max-width: 1023px) { #spl-weather-heading-4c9cede2a679 .spl-weather-section-heading-text {letter-spacing: 0px;}#spl-weather-heading-4c9cede2a679 .spl-weather-section-sub-heading-text {letter-spacing: 0px;} } @media only screen and (max-width: 599px) {#spl-weather-heading-4c9cede2a679 .spl-weather-section-heading-text {letter-spacing: 0px;}#spl-weather-heading-4c9cede2a679 .spl-weather-section-sub-heading-text {letter-spacing: 0px;}}
/* CSS for sp-location-weather-pro/windy-map - spl-weather-windy-map-c8a55fcefa95 */
#spl-weather-windy-map-c8a55fcefa95 .spl-weather-map-template {padding: 20px 20px 20px 20px;max-width: 1200px;height: 700px;border-style: solid;border-color: #f0f0f0;border-width: 1px 1px 1px 1px;border-radius: 8px 8px 8px 8px;box-shadow:  0px 3px 6px 0px #00000026;} @media only screen and (min-width: 600px) and (max-width: 1023px) { #spl-weather-windy-map-c8a55fcefa95 .spl-weather-map-template {max-width: 950px;height: 500px;}#spl-weather-windy-map-c8a55fcefa95 {display: block;} } @media only screen and (max-width: 599px) {#spl-weather-windy-map-c8a55fcefa95 .spl-weather-map-template {max-width: 400px;height: 400px;}#spl-weather-windy-map-c8a55fcefa95 {display: block;}}
/* CSS for sp-location-weather-pro/section-heading - spl-weather-heading-386ac6527f2c */
#spl-weather-heading-386ac6527f2c .spl-weather-section-heading-text {font-size: 23px;line-height: 27px;letter-spacing: 0px;color: #718096;font-weight: 500;background: transparent;padding: 0px 0px 0px 0px;border-style: none;border-radius: 0px 0px 0px 0px;}#spl-weather-heading-386ac6527f2c .spl-weather-section-sub-heading-text {font-size: 16px;line-height: 19px;letter-spacing: 0px;color: oklch(from #3182CE calc(l + 0.10 * (1 - l)) calc(c * 1.00) calc(h + 180) / 100%);font-weight: 500;background: transparent;padding: 0px 0px 0px 0px;border-style: none;border-radius: 0px 0px 0px 0px;}#spl-weather-heading-386ac6527f2c.spl-weather-section-heading-block-wrapper {gap: 5px;background: transparent;border-style: none;border-radius: 0px 0px 0px 0px;padding: 0px 0px 0px 0px;margin: 90px 0px 40px 0px;}#spl-weather-heading-386ac6527f2c.spl-weather-section-heading-block-wrapper > div {justify-content: left;} @media only screen and (min-width: 600px) and (max-width: 1023px) { #spl-weather-heading-386ac6527f2c .spl-weather-section-heading-text {letter-spacing: 0px;}#spl-weather-heading-386ac6527f2c .spl-weather-section-sub-heading-text {letter-spacing: 0px;} } @media only screen and (max-width: 599px) {#spl-weather-heading-386ac6527f2c .spl-weather-section-heading-text {letter-spacing: 0px;}#spl-weather-heading-386ac6527f2c .spl-weather-section-sub-heading-text {letter-spacing: 0px;}}
/* CSS for sp-location-weather-pro/windy-map - spl-weather-windy-map-fb9d77246659 */
#spl-weather-windy-map-fb9d77246659 .spl-weather-map-template {padding: 20px 20px 20px 20px;max-width: 1200px;height: 700px;border-style: solid;border-color: #f0f0f0;border-width: 1px 1px 1px 1px;border-radius: 8px 8px 8px 8px;box-shadow:  0px 3px 6px 0px #00000026;} @media only screen and (min-width: 600px) and (max-width: 1023px) { #spl-weather-windy-map-fb9d77246659 .spl-weather-map-template {max-width: 950px;height: 500px;}#spl-weather-windy-map-fb9d77246659 {display: block;} } @media only screen and (max-width: 599px) {#spl-weather-windy-map-fb9d77246659 .spl-weather-map-template {max-width: 400px;height: 400px;}#spl-weather-windy-map-fb9d77246659 {display: block;}}
/* CSS for sp-location-weather-pro/section-heading - spl-weather-heading-d95d93b3f2fa */
#spl-weather-heading-d95d93b3f2fa .spl-weather-section-heading-text {font-size: 23px;line-height: 27px;letter-spacing: 0px;color: #718096;font-weight: 500;background: transparent;padding: 0px 0px 0px 0px;border-style: none;border-radius: 0px 0px 0px 0px;}#spl-weather-heading-d95d93b3f2fa .spl-weather-section-sub-heading-text {font-size: 16px;line-height: 19px;letter-spacing: 0px;color: oklch(from #3182CE calc(l + 0.10 * (1 - l)) calc(c * 1.00) calc(h + 180) / 100%);font-weight: 500;background: transparent;padding: 0px 0px 0px 0px;border-style: none;border-radius: 0px 0px 0px 0px;}#spl-weather-heading-d95d93b3f2fa.spl-weather-section-heading-block-wrapper {gap: 5px;background: transparent;border-style: none;border-radius: 0px 0px 0px 0px;padding: 0px 0px 0px 0px;margin: 90px 0px 40px 0px;}#spl-weather-heading-d95d93b3f2fa.spl-weather-section-heading-block-wrapper > div {justify-content: left;} @media only screen and (min-width: 600px) and (max-width: 1023px) { #spl-weather-heading-d95d93b3f2fa .spl-weather-section-heading-text {letter-spacing: 0px;}#spl-weather-heading-d95d93b3f2fa .spl-weather-section-sub-heading-text {letter-spacing: 0px;} } @media only screen and (max-width: 599px) {#spl-weather-heading-d95d93b3f2fa .spl-weather-section-heading-text {letter-spacing: 0px;}#spl-weather-heading-d95d93b3f2fa .spl-weather-section-sub-heading-text {letter-spacing: 0px;}}
/* CSS for sp-location-weather-pro/windy-map - spl-weather-windy-map-4b572b8ea83d */
#spl-weather-windy-map-4b572b8ea83d .spl-weather-map-template {padding: 20px 20px 20px 20px;max-width: 1200px;height: 700px;border-style: solid;border-color: #f0f0f0;border-width: 1px 1px 1px 1px;border-radius: 8px 8px 8px 8px;box-shadow:  0px 3px 6px 0px #00000026;} @media only screen and (min-width: 600px) and (max-width: 1023px) { #spl-weather-windy-map-4b572b8ea83d .spl-weather-map-template {max-width: 950px;height: 500px;}#spl-weather-windy-map-4b572b8ea83d {display: block;} } @media only screen and (max-width: 599px) {#spl-weather-windy-map-4b572b8ea83d .spl-weather-map-template {max-width: 400px;height: 400px;}#spl-weather-windy-map-4b572b8ea83d {display: block;}}